Honeywell International is a diversified technology and manufacturing leader of aerospace products and services; control technologies for buildings, homes and industry; automotive products; power generation systems; specialty chemicals; fibers; plastics and advanced materials.


The company is committed to providing quality products, integrated system solutions and services to customers around the world. Honeywell products touch the lives of most people everyday, whether you're flying on a plane, driving a car, heating or cooling a home, furnishing an apartment, taking medication for an illness or playing a sport.


Based in Morris Township, N.J., Honeywell employs approximately 125,000 people in 120 countries. Its shares are traded on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ol HON, as well as on the London, Chicago and Pacific Stock Exchanges. It is one of the 30 stocks that make up the Dow Jones Industrial Average and is also a component of the Standard & Poor's 500 Index.


Honeywell Process Solutions (HPS) is a strategic business unit in Automation and Control Solutions (ACS). HPS improves the safety, reliability, efficiency and sustainability of industrial facilities on every continent around the world. With more than 12,000 employees in 120 countries, HPS offers a full range of industry-leading automation and control solutions and advanced software applications to key vertical industries, including oil & gas, mining, refining, pulp & paper, power, chemical, and life sciences. The Honeywell Operating System (HOS) is a disciplined, lean process oriented set of standardized guidelines and principles intended to improve productivity, quality, lower costs and mitigate waste as well as establish a sustainable environment for never ending improvement. This position reports directly to the Plant Manager/Site Leader and functionally to the HOS Group Leader or SBG HOS Leader. The position is responsible for deploying HOS through the Standard Implementation Framework (SIF) across the site, particularly the following aspects:


  • Employee & Leadership Engagement plan

  • Communication plan

  • Development of case for change

  • Enhance goal deployment to all individuals

  • Goal definition & deployment

  • Kaizen training & involvement
